I am trying to use a geometry binary predicate (ST_Intersects) in ExecuteSQL() with the SQLite dialect and keep getting back an "ST_Intersect function does not exist" error back from SQLite.

GDAL is built with SpatiaLite (HAVE_SPATIALITE is defined), but I believe the problem is that SpatiaLite is built without GEOS in our case, so those predicate functions end-up not being available in SpatiaLite. The end result is that OGRSQLiteRegisterSQLFunctions does not add the OGR-based predicate functions as SpatiaLite is present, but SpatiaLite does not contain the predicate functions.

I would build SpatiaLite with GEOS support, but unfortunately its LGPL licensing is too restrictive for our application. So, would it make sense to change the logic in OGRSQLiteRegisterSQLFunctions to account for the case of SpatiaLite being built without GEOS?
